Commercial Generator Servicing in Utah County, UT
Commercial generator servicing involves routine inspections, maintenance, and repairs to ensure backup power systems operate reliably when needed. This service covers a variety of generator types commonly used in commercial properties, including standby generators, portable units, and industrial-grade systems. Property owners often request this service to prevent unexpected outages, protect critical equipment, and maintain compliance with safety standards. Understanding the specific generator model, its age, and usage history can help determine the appropriate servicing needs before requesting assistance.
Homeowners and property owners typically want to know what maintenance tasks are included, such as checking fuel systems, testing automatic transfer switches, and inspecting electrical connections. They also inquire about recommended service intervals and signs that indicate a generator may need repairs or parts replacement. Clarifying these details ensures the system will function properly during power outages, providing peace of mind for residential and commercial properties alike.

Commercial Generator Servicing Questions
Why is regular servicing important for commercial generators? Routine maintenance helps ensure reliable operation, prevents unexpected breakdowns, and extends the lifespan of the generator system.
What types of commercial generators typically require servicing? Generators used for backup power in retail stores, office buildings, warehouses, and other commercial properties benefit from regular servicing.
What does commercial generator servicing include? Servicing generally involves inspecting, cleaning, testing, and replacing worn components to keep the generator functioning efficiently.
How often should commercial generators be serviced? It is recommended to have generators checked periodically, with more frequent service for units in heavy use or extreme conditions.
